13,103,107,360 is an even composite number composed of five prime numbers multiplied together.
13103107360 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of ninety-six divisors.
Prime factorization of 13103107360:
25 × 5 × 7 × 23 × 508661
(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 7 × 23 × 508661)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 13103107360 from the Numbermatics database.

-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 36916653312
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 23813545952
- 13103107360 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(23813545952)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 10710438592
